If You're Not Connected Emotionally To A Story, Then You're Dead. You're As A Filmmaker Really Just Opening The Door For People To Lose Interest And Their Minds To Wander, For Them To Start Picking It Apart. That's What People Will Do, People Will Naturally Tear Stuff Apart Because They're Trapped With It, They Paid Money For It. And They Came Into It Wanting To Love It. So All You Can Really Do Is Piss Off The Audience. Unless You Do Things Right.
